Vigil@nce - Linux kernel: denial of service via xsaves/xrstors

March 2015 by Vigil@nce

This bulletin was written by Vigil@nce : http://vigilance.fr/offer

SYNTHESIS OF THE VULNERABILITY

An attacker can use xsaves/xrstors on the Linux kernel, in order
to trigger a denial of service.

Impacted products: Linux

Severity: 1/4

Creation date: 18/03/2015

DESCRIPTION OF THE VULNERABILITY

The XSAVES instruction saves the state of the Processor Extended
States Supervisor. The XRSTORS instruction restores it.

However, a local attacker can use these instructions to trigger a
fatal error in the kernel, due to an invalid label name.

An attacker can therefore use xsaves/xrstors on the Linux kernel,
in order to trigger a denial of service.
